Os algoritmos de ordenação são importantes para organizar dados de forma eficiente. A pesquisa linear procura itens de forma sequencial enquanto a binária divide o espaço de busca pela metade a cada passo. Árvores binárias balanceadas mantêm a altura similar em todos os nós. A prova também cobre inserção e remoção de valores em árvores binárias de busca.
Os algoritmos de ordenação são importantes para organizar dados de forma eficiente. A pesquisa linear procura itens de forma sequencial enquanto a binária divide o espaço de busca pela metade a cada passo. Árvores binárias balanceadas mantêm a altura similar em todos os nós. A prova também cobre inserção e remoção de valores em árvores binárias de busca.
Os algoritmos de ordenação são importantes para organizar dados de forma eficiente. A pesquisa linear procura itens de forma sequencial enquanto a binária divide o espaço de busca pela metade a cada passo. Árvores binárias balanceadas mantêm a altura similar em todos os nós. A prova também cobre inserção e remoção de valores em árvores binárias de busca.
1. Por que os algoritmos de ordenação(Sorting) são importantes? [3.0]
2. O que é uma pesquisa linear? [2.0] 3. Como funciona a pesquisa binária? [3.0] 4. Quando uma árvore binária e considerada balanceada? [3.0] 5. Uma árvore binária de busca serve para o armazenamento de dados na memória do computador e a sua subsequente recuperação. a) Inserir em uma ABB inicialmente vazia, os seguintes valores: 6 4 8 2 5 1 3 7 9 6 [2.0] b) Retira em uma ABB o seguintes valore 7 [3.0] c) Retira em uma ABB o seguintes valore o 4 [4.0]